Lidl UK has announced a third pay rise for its staff within a 12-month period, effective in June, with the new starting hourly rate set at £13.65 in London and £12.40 in other regions. This increase, which is over 3%, is part of Lidl's efforts to match competitor Aldi and surpass other UK rivals in terms of employee compensation. The pay adjustment is expected to benefit thousands of Lidl workers across the country.
